SPREAD THE WORD
Philadelphia, the cream cheese, now comes in a new, plantbased version, exclusively at Tesco. The recipe combines oats and almonds and, says its makers, Mondelēz International, has lost none of its creaminess. With more and more shoppers looking for plant-based alternatives, it’s good news for cream cheese lovers reluctant to leave their favourite spread behind. Gut feeling
If your gut bacteria needs a helping hand, then it might be worth adding Bio & Me’s new strawberry yoghurt to your shopping list. The prebiotic yogurt is packed with live cultures, but no added sugar, artificial sweeteners, thickening agents or emulsifiers. Looking for an alternative to refined sugar? Date Syrup from The Groovy Food Company is made from nothing but dates and is versatile enough to use in all manner of baked treats. It’s organic, suitable for vegans, low in fat and a naturally low-GI sugar substitute. Exclusively available at Tesco, £2.80; groovyfood.co.uk
